Defend the Body from Within

Imagine shrinking down to a microscopic size and stepping inside the human body. That is exactly where you find yourself in Vaxine, a unique first-person shooter puzzle game that takes place entirely within the President of the United States. Instead of fighting soldiers or monsters on a battlefield, your enemies are biological threats. Your mission is simple but intense: protect the healthy base cells from being overrun by invading virus cells.

The game drops you into a surreal, ray-traced 3D world that feels like walking through a strange, half-sphere laboratory. The environment is filled with toroidal grids and abstract medical structures, creating a visual style that was quite advanced for its time. You are not just shooting blindly; you are managing a critical resource while trying to survive in a hostile biological ecosystem.

Combat in Vaxine revolves around a clever color-matching mechanic. You control a character armed with antibodies, which appear as colored spheres. When viruses attack your base cells, you must lob these antibodies at them to destroy the threat. However, there is a catch: you can only destroy a virus if the color of your antibody matches the color of the virus cell. This means you have to constantly monitor the incoming threats and ensure you have the right ammunition ready for each specific enemy type.

The challenge lies in resource management. You have limited ammunition for each color, and running out of any single color results in an immediate game over. This adds a layer of tension to every encounter. You cannot just spray bullets everywhere; you must be strategic about which enemies you engage with and when. If you ignore a group of viruses, they will eventually reach the base cells, causing damage that could lead to your defeat.

Another key element of the gameplay is time pressure. The game features 'Spitters,' enemy types that generate new attacking cells over time. If you do not complete levels quickly enough, these spitters will overwhelm you with a constant stream of new threats. This forces you to move efficiently through the surreal rooms, clearing out enemies before they can multiply and make the situation unmanageable.

The atmosphere is distinctively odd and immersive. Because the game takes place inside a body, the scale feels intimate yet vast. The ray-traced graphics give the environment a polished, almost glass-like appearance, which contrasts with the chaotic nature of the biological warfare you are fighting. It feels less like a traditional war and more like a high-stakes medical emergency where you are the only line of defense.

As you progress, the difficulty ramps up. You will face larger numbers of viruses, more complex room layouts, and tighter time limits. The combination of color-matching puzzles and fast-paced shooting requires quick thinking and steady hands. You must balance the need to destroy immediate threats with the need to preserve your ammunition for future encounters.

Developed by The Assembly Line and published by U.S. Gold, Vaxine stands out as a creative experiment in game design. It blends action with puzzle elements in a way that feels fresh and engaging. The medical theme is handled with a sense of wonder rather than horror, making the experience more about strategic survival than visceral combat.
